Build a privileged account "bank" for the data center

 

Palladium's technical director Wang Feng said that the problems faced by traditional bastion machines and the change in the positioning of bastion machines in the data center are important reasons for the release of the next generation of bastion machines.

 

In general, traditional bastion machines face the following dilemmas:

 

o Cannot support large concurrency and cluster expansion;

 

o Cannot support the use of privileged accounts on the automation platform, and cannot cooperate with the process operation and maintenance of ITSM (IT service management), CMDB (configuration management database) and other systems;

 

o Cannot support operation and maintenance and access control on the mobile terminal;

 

o Cannot support visual authorization;

 

o Unable to automatically collect account information.

 

Palladium believes that the next-generation fortress machine, namely the privileged account management center, is to become the "privileged identity bank" of the data center, it must realize the automatic operation and maintenance platform through the programmable API to ensure its access to assets; At the same time, for the security of privileged accounts, active security assessment and convenient management can be carried out; combined with the management and control of data upload/download channels, a secure closed loop can be realized.



 

As the pioneer of the traditional bastion machine, from a technical perspective, Wang Feng believes that Palladium’s important advantages or thresholds have two points. One is the maturity and stability of the bastion machine itself, which is reflected in the ability to deploy super-large clusters. reflect.

 

"Our bank has many customers, and they value the reliability of the fortress machine very much."

 

The second point is the security of the fortress itself.

 

According to Wang Feng, Palladium’s fortress machine is the first choice of OEMs for many ICT manufacturers, especially for export to overseas markets. Not only because of its performance and capabilities, but also in terms of safety, Palladium has also put a lot of effort into it.

 

"Foreign markets pay special attention to the security of the bastion machine itself. At the beginning, we spent a year and a half of our research and development energy in the security reinforcement of the product. We support 8-10 identity authentication modes. At the same time, we regard the bastion machine as a For back-end applications, there is a complete set of security enhancement solutions, including WAF for bastion machines, whitelisting of parameters and URLs, and a security monitoring system for bastion machine databases."

 

Whether it is maturity and stability, or security, these are difficult to achieve in a short time for open source fortresses.

In addition, regarding the relationship between the bastion host and IAM, Wang Feng believes that the bastion host is limited by the bandwidth of the operation and maintenance agreement, and pays more attention to the access of the operation and maintenance personnel. IAM is an identity system that covers all business lines. It can be said that the bastion is IAM's A sub-module. However, the bastion host's control of identity and authority, as well as the audit and monitoring of access behavior (which is also the content of 4A), can be traced back to natural persons and can be expanded even more. This demand does exist.
